How they compare
Poland currently reports 156.14 1000 USD against 103.7 1000 USD in Uzbekistan, a difference of 52.44 1000 USD.
That makes Poland's figure about 1.5 times Uzbekistan's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 11 shared years of data; in 2009 it was Poland ahead.
Poland ranks 34th and Uzbekistan ranks 37th of 92 countries.
Poland has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

About this data
The Fertilizers by Product dataset contains information on the Production, Trade and Agriculture Use of inorganic (chemical or mineral) fertilizers products. The fertilizer statistics data are for a set of 23 product categories. Both straight and compound fertilizers are included.
